### Step 4: Swap out the old queue

Quick one for the sync: we're finally retiring Gruntwork, our homegrown job queue, in favor of Pellet. Drain the old workers first, flip the PELLET_PRIMARY flag, then redeploy the schedulers. The Pellet worker image is signed, so verify it before rollout using the key below.

release key, fajef-kajeg: bky19_LdLu6Ne6FLi8he2c24d

Broker upgrade notes for Quillbus 4.x at Hartenfell Systems. Upgrades are rolling: drain one node, upgrade, verify, proceed. Audit logging stays enabled throughout; no downgrade path past schema migration. Re-sealing the credentials vault after the final node requires the standing recovery passphrase, which is kept on the line directly below.

vault phrase of bagaf-kajeg = jorath-feniel-briir-siliel-ralix

# Basement Archive Room — Night Access

The archive room under Pellworth House holds old contracts and the tape backups. Night shift: take stairwell C, not the lift (it's switched off after midnight). Lights are on a timer by the door — slap the button as you go in. Sign the logbook, even at 3am, yes really. The keypad by the door takes the code below.

staff pass of fahap-tajeg = bdg-FT-6

Test plan note — TerraTally offline mode (weekly eng sync): We'll verify that survey drafts created in airplane mode persist through app restarts, then sync cleanly once connectivity returns. Edge cases include conflicting edits from two devices and partial photo uploads. QA will run the matrix on the Foxglove staging cluster. To replay the sync queue against staging, authenticate with the token below.

login token, kagaf-bawig: eyJhbGciOiJIUzI1NiIsInR5cCI6IkpXVCJ9.eyJzdWIiOiI1b8bmcIn0.xjc0uBP3